Description

Kotlin is a modern, expressive, and concise programming language popular among developers for its many benefits. These include its interoperability with Java, ability to build native mobile and web applications, and support for functional programming.

This book provides a comprehensive introduction to Kotlin, covering everything you need to know to start building Kotlin applications, regardless of your prior programming experience.

You’ll start by learning the basics of Kotlin, including its variables, types, functions, and control flow statements. Then, you’ll explore more advanced topics such as object-oriented programming, generics, coroutines, RxKotlin, and multiplatform development. Once you have a solid foundation in Kotlin, you’ll learn how to use it to build real-world applications. You’ll start with a simple Android application and then move on to more complex projects, such as a web application and a desktop application.

By the end of this book, you will have a deep understanding of Kotlin and be confident in your ability to use it to build robust, maintainable, and scalable applications.
